Analysts, economists and business leaders have chimed in on what to expect from the 2023 budget speech this week Wednesday , including Eskom debt management, taxes, grants and more.
Prof Andre Roux, an economist at Stellenbosch Business School, said that a year ago, rolling blackouts were sporadic and irritating; today, load-shedding is pervasive and intrusive. Talk of taking on a substantial share of Eskom’s debt has been pervasive. During the finance minister’s medium-term budget policy statement last year, he said that the economy and public finances are most in danger from Eskom’s performance.
This means there is unlikely to be a VAT hike, or the introduction of a wealth tax, and the tax rates for personal income also aren’t expected to be shifted higher. Some have suggested that the best-case would be a rebate offered to households, deducted against any deductable income for all components – including installation – of solar equipment.
The so-called social wage will likely be increased to help the poor, Momentum said. This includes things like free water, free electricity, free schooling, the free university, free health services, social relief grant and other social grants.
